Modulation and Utility of DCAF10-associated CRL4 Ubiquitin Ligase Complexes Targeting Proteins for Proteolysis
This technology utilizes the CRL4-DCAF10 ubiquitin ligase complex to target and tag specific proteins for proteasomal degradation. By using chemical inhibitors and engineered PROTAC molecules, the system recruits target proteins to catalyze their destruction and control cellular protein levels. Systems and Methods for Concurrent Biochemical Immunoassay and Cellular Traction Force Measurement in Hydrogels
This invention relates to a platform that couples bead-based immunoassays with 3D traction force microscopy (TFM) within a single hydrogel substrate to quantify time-resolved biochemical cues and cell-generated mechanical forces at matched locations. Fully Wearable Band for Long-Term Peripheral Ultrasound Neuromodulation in Pain Management
Wearable ultrasound neuromodulation device for peripheral nerve pain relief A wearable ultrasound armband uses a focused piezoelectric transducer and acoustic hydrogel to deliver low-intensity ultrasound pulses to peripheral nerves, noninvasively reducing chronic and neuropathic pain for several hours.
